I purchased the ebike conversion kit, (Smart Pie External) that came with brake levers but I was unable to use them because my gears are incorporated in by brakes. Golden Motor sent me brake sensors which seem to be a magnetic cut switch with adhesive tape and some kind of small ring which I think may not be part of the brake sensor??

Anyway, does anyone have any knowledge of the best way to install this cut switch/sensor? on my factory brake levers which are not hydraulic?

You may have to experiment with the distance between the magnet and the sensor to see if you can get the motor to cut out just before the mechanical brake start to grab. This will allow regen to be activated without having to pull the lever so far that the brake pads start to rub against the brake disc/wheel rim.  ;)



Hopefully your brake levers and sensors will be very similar to the ones shown above.
